Adidas and Team GB Reveal Traditional Uniform For 2024 Paris Olympic and Paralympic Games

Last week, Great Britain and Adidas unveiled Team Great Britain’s official uniform ahead of the 2032 Paris Olympic and Paralympic Games.

The uniform, characterised by their navy colour with red and white trim, reflects a traditional and understated approach.

Designed with a nod to British heritage, including the Union Jack placed on the left sleeve fo each uniform, the design aligns with a broader trend in sports apparel to avoid controversy while focusing on the athletes’ needs and national identity.

Adidas has also prepared white tracksuits for podium appearances, designed to complement the medals athletes will aim to win.

The uniform has drawn mixed reactions, with some praising the simplicity of the design and others deeming it uninspiring. Tom Daley and Olivia Breen, both veteran Olympians, have expressed their approval of the kits, highlighting the fresh feel and the motivational boost that well-designed sportswear can provide.

The partnership between Adidas and Team Great Britain reflects a commitment to heritage, comfort and functionality when it comes to sports attire.
